Calories in EGG, POTATO & CHEESE BREAKFAST WRAPS

Serving Size: 1 Serving (204.0g)
Amount Per Serving
  • Calories 410.0
  • Total Fat 12.0 g
  • Saturated Fat 3.5 g
  • Cholesterol 95.9 mg
  • Sodium 599.8 mg
  • Potassium 0.0 mg
  • Total Carbohydrate 59.0 g
  • Dietary Fiber 2.0 g
  • Sugars 1.0 g
  • Protein 14.0 g
  • Vitamin A 199.9 IU
  • Vitamin B-12 0.0 µg
  • Vitamin B-6 0.0 mg
  • Vitamin C 4.9 mg
  • Vitamin D 0.0 IU
  • Vitamin E 0.0 mg
  • Calcium 100.0 mg
  • Copper 0.0 mg
  • Folate 0.0 µg
  • Iron 3.6 mg
  • Magnesium 0.0 mg
  • Manganese 0.0 mg
  • Niacin 0.0 mg
  • Pantothenic Acid 0.0 mg
  • Phosphorus 0.0 mg
  • Riboflavin 0.0 mg
  • Thiamin 0.0 mg
  • Zinc 0.0 mg

Ingredients

WHEAT FLOUR (ENRICHED WITH NIACIN, REDUCED IRON, THIAMIN MONONITRATE, RIBOFLAVIN, FOLIC ACID), WATER, SCRAMBLED EGGS (PASTEURIZED WHOLE EGGS, NONFAT MILK, SOYBEAN OIL, MODIFIED FOOD STARCH, SALT, XANTHAN GUM, CITRIC ACID, BUTTER FLAVOR (MALTODEXTRIN, BUTTER FLAVOR, ANNATTO AND TURMERIC (ADDED FOR COLOR)), SPICE), POTATOES (WITH SALT), PROCESSED CHEDDAR CHEESE (PASTEURIZED PROCESS CHEDDAR CHEESE (CHEDDAR CHEESE (MILK, CHEESE CULTURE, SALT, ENZYMES), WATER, SODIUM PHOSPHATE, MILKFAT, SODIUM HEXAMETAPHOSPHATE, SALT, ARTIFICIAL COLOR), GREEN CHILIES (WITH SALT, CITRIC ACID, CALCIUM CHLORIDE), TOMATOES (WITH JUICE, CITRIC ACID, CALCIUM CHLORIDE), VEGETABLE OIL (SOYBEAN, CANOLA, PALM AND/OR CORN OIL), CONTAINS 2% OR LESS CHEESE (ENZYME MODIFIED CHEDDAR CHEESE (PASTEURIZED MILK, CHEESE CULTURES, SALT, ENZYMES), WATER, BUTTER (CREAM, SALT), SALT, NATURAL FLAVOR, SODIUM PHOSPHATE, LACTIC ACID, ENZYMES, VEGETABLE COLORING), ONION, JALAPENO PEPPERS (WITH SALT, ACETIC ACID, WATER, CALCIUM CHLORIDE), MODIFIED CORN STARCH, SALT, SPICE, DOUGH CONDITIONERS (WHEAT GLUTEN, SUGAR, YEAST, GUAR GUM, MODIFIED FOOD STARCH, SODIUM METABISULFITE).

Calorie Analysis

The food EGG, POTATO & CHEESE BREAKFAST WRAPS, based on the serving size listed above, would account for 20.5% of your daily allotted calories based on a 2,000 calorie diet. The majority of the calories for this food comes from carbohydrates. Carbohydrates make up 57.6% of the calories.
